Praying always with all prayer and supplication in the Spirit – Ephesians 6:18
Remember to pray often. Paul here says we are to be praying always. He admonished the church at Thessalonica to “pray without ceasing” (1 Thessalonians 5:17). This indicates that our whole life is to be constantly bathed in prayer.
